Introduction The theory of fuzzy sets which was introduced by Zadeh [6] is applied to many mathematical branches. Abou-zoid [1], introduced the notion of a fuzzy sub near-ring and studied fuzzy ideals of near-ring. This concept discussed by many researchers among cho, Davvaz, Dudek, Jun, Kim [2],[3],[4]. In [5], considered the intuitionistic fuzzification of a right (resp left ) R- subgroup in a near-ring. Also cho.at.al in [4] the notion of normal intuitionistic fuzzy R- subgroup in a near-ring is introduced and related properties are investigated. The notion of intuitionistic Q- fuzzy semi primality in a semi group is given by Kim [3]. A.Solairaju and R.Nagarajan introduced the concept of Structures of Q- fuzzy groups [7]. In this paper, We introduce the notion of anti Q- fuzzification of right R- subgroups in a near ring and investigate some related properties. Characterization of anti Q- fuzzy right- subgroups with respect to S-norm are given.
2 172 G. Subbiah and R. Balakrishnan Preliminaries Definition 2.1: A non empty set with two binary operations + and. is called a near-ring if it satisfies the following axioms ( R,+ ) is a group. ( R,. ) is a semi group. x. (y+z) = x.y + x. z for all x,y,z ε R. Precisely speaking it is a left near-ring. Because it satisfies the left distributive law As R subgroup of a near- ring R is a subset H of R such that ( H, + ) is a subgroup of ( R, + ). RH H HR H. If H satisfies (i) and (ii) then it is called left R- subgroup of R and if H satisfies (i) and (iii) then it is called a right R- subgroup of R. A map f : R S is called homomorphism if f(x+y) = f(x) + f (y) for all x,y in R. Definition 2.2: Let Q and G be a set and a group respectively. A mapping μ: G Q [0,1] is called a Q fuzzy set. Definition 2.3: Let R be a near ring. A fuzzy set μ in R is called anti fuzzy sub near ring in R if (i) μ(x+y) Max { μ(x), μ(y) } (ii) μ(xy) Max { μ(x), μ(y) } for all x,y in R. Definition 2.4: A Q -fuzzy set μ is called a anti Q-fuzzy right R- subgroup of R over Q if μ satisfies (AQFS1) μ(x+y,q ) S { μ(x,q ), μ(y,q) } (AQFS2) μ(xr, q ) μ(x q). (AQFS3) A(0,q ) = 1 Definition 2.5: By a s- norm S, we mean a function S: [0,1] [0,1] [0,1] satisfying the following conditions (S1) S(x,0) = x (S2) S(x,y) S(x,z) if y z (S3) S(x,y) = S(y,x) (S4) S(x, S(y,z) ) = S(S(x,y),z), for all x,y,z ε [0,1]. Definition 2.6: Define S n (x 1,x 2,, x n ) = S (x i, S n-1 (x 1,x 2, x i-1, x i+1,x n )) for all 1 i n, n 2, S 1 = S. Also define S (x 1,x 2, ) = lim S n (x 1,x 2,,x n ) as n. Definition 2.7: By the union of Q-fuzzy subsets A 1 and A 2 in a set X with respect to s-norm S we mean the Q-fuzzy subset A = A 1 U A 2 in the set X such that for any x ε X A(x,q) = (A 1 UA 2 ) (x,q) = S (A 1 (x,q), A 2 (x,q)). By the union of a collection of Q-fuzzy subsets { A 1,A 2, } in a set X with respect to a s- norm S we mean the Q-fuzzy subset UA i such that for any x ε A, (UA i )(x,q) = S (A 1 (x,q), A 2 (x,q),}.
